Linahon repeats as Academic All-American

PELLA – For the second year in a row, Central College men’s wrestler Gage Linahon (senior, Newton) was chosen as an Academic All-American by the College Sports Communicators Wednesday.

Linahon became the first Dutch wrestler to earn the honor last season. Wrestling does not have its own Academic All-America team, but Linahon was chosen for the first team in the At-Large program alongside athletes from sports like fencing, golf, ice hockey, lacrosse, skiing and water polo. Linahon was one of just three wrestlers to be chosen for the first team.

To be eligible for consideration, a student-athlete must be a starter or key reserve at the varsity level and achieve a 3.50 or better cumulative grade point average. Being selected for the Academic All-District team is also a prerequisite.

Linahon finished the season 31-7 at 197 pounds, placing second at the Lower Midwest Regional. His placement in the regional earned him a third consecutive trip to the NCAA Division III Championships. He has a career record of 83-26 with three individual tournament titles.

Central set a new school standard with eight total CSC Academic All-Americans selected during the 2023-24 school year. Dating back to 1979, Central has had 80 Academic All-America awards earned by 63 individuals.
